The Role:
As a Higher-Level Teaching Assistant (HLTA), you will play a key role in supporting the class teacher to deliver lessons across a variety of subjects. Your focus will be on providing personalised assistance to individual students and small groups. You will assist in planning lessons, help create an engaging and inclusive classroom environment, and work to ensure that every student achieves their full potential. Key Responsibilities:
- Support class teachers in delivering engaging lessons and help ensure that students remain focused and make progress.
- Provide one-on-one and small group support to students, both inside and outside the classroom.
- Contribute to maintaining a positive and inclusive classroom atmosphere.
- Assist with supporting students' emotional well-being and social development.
- Help with administrative tasks such as preparing learning resources and tracking student progress.
- Offer targeted interventions for children with additional needs when necessary.
- Maintain effective communication with parents, teachers, and staff.
